Bushfires October 2023

Q: Is Hat Head Holiday Park park open?

A: The park is officially closed for arrivals 18 October and 19 October 2023 based on advice from RFS.

Q: When can we access the park?

A: We do not have an indicative timeframe at this time however when the emergency services advise it is safe to do so, we will reopen the park.  We will keep you informed through SMS and our website for the most up-to-date advice.

Q: How will we know when we can access the park?

A: We will keep you informed through SMS and email as soon as this information becomes available.

Q: Is the road into Hat Head open?

A: Hat Head Road currently remains closed.

Q: Are there any alternative access roads?

A: There are no alternative access roads.

Q: Did the fire reach Hat Head?

A: The fire was in close proximity to Hat Head but did not reach the town centre or Hat Head Holiday Park directly.

Q: Are my belongings safe?

A: The park is currently closed so we have not been able to access or review any belongings since the evacuation 17 October.

Q: Will I receive a refund for my shortened stay?

A: Yes, refunds or credits will be provided for any cancelled or shortened stays as a result of this evacuation or closure.  We will notify you via email regarding your bookings.

Q: Can I come and get some of my belongings now but pick up the caravan later?

A: The park currently remains closed and access to the park will not be gained until the area is deemed accessible by RFS which we will keep you updated via SMS or website.
